Senior Kubernetes & Infrastructure Engineer

Third Wave Automation
Union City, CA

Company Description

Third Wave Automation is a rapidly growing startup that has demonstrated its core technology components, proven its market fit, and just closed its Series C funding. If you are excited about cutting edge machine learning, robotics that affects the real world, and want to join a company where your skills can have a huge impact, you’ll fit right in.

Third Wave Automation is applying modern machine learning to materials handling—delivering site-specific forklift navigation and infrastructure-free pallet handling that continuously adapts to changing floor configuration and warehouse demand.

Job Description

Third Wave Automation is looking for a Senior Kubernetes & Infrastructure Engineer to help us build and scale the core systems powering our autonomous forklifts. This is a high-impact individual contributor role focused on designing, deploying, and debugging the robust, scalable, and efficient software infrastructure that supports our real-time, safety-critical robotic systems. You'll be a key player in our cloud and on-premise environments, ensuring our systems are reliable and performant at scale.

How You Can Make an Impact


  • Design and Implement Deployment Strategies: Architect and implement deployment strategies for new services, focusing on reliability and scalability across both cloud and on-premises environments.

  • Debug and Maintain Kubernetes Clusters: Take ownership of debugging complex issues within our on-premise and edge Kubernetes clusters, ensuring system reliability under real-world conditions.

  • Develop and Maintain Helm Charts: Create, optimize, and manage Helm charts to streamline the packaging and deployment of our robotic applications.

  • Optimize Networked Systems: Design and troubleshoot complex networked systems used in communication between vehicles, edge systems, and cloud services.

  • Improve Core Infrastructure: Contribute to the design and implementation of core infrastructure components in the cloud and on-premises.

  • Automate and Expand: Develop and maintain infrastructure as code to ensure the scalability and reliability of systems

  • Collaborate and Lead: Partner with autonomy, perception, and other infrastructure teams to operationalize robotics software, and mentor other engineers on best practices for deployment and systems reliability.

Desired Qualifications


  • 8+ years of experience in software engineering, with at least 2+ years in a senior individual contributor capacity.

  • Deep expertise in Kubernetes, including experience with on-premises deployments, debugging, and advanced networking.

  • Proven hands-on experience creating and managing Helm charts and designing deployment strategies.

  • Thorough understanding of network protocols, distributed system design, and fault-tolerant communication.

  • Understanding of Linux internals: namespaces, containers, filesystems and networking

  • Proficiency in Terraform, Pulumi or other Infrastructure as Code platform

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

Bonus Points For


  • Experience working in robotics, autonomous vehicles, or other real-time/safety-critical systems.

  • Familiarity with container runtimes and edge deployment strategies.

  • Exposure to real-time networking, QoS, or time synchronization in distributed systems.
